    Abstract: Where a subsea well is completed for production or water injection service, a subsea christmas tree must sealably connect with both the wellhead and the pipeline(s) or subsea manifold template pipework in order that fluids may flow out of (or into) the well. An intermediate series of pipework loops mounted within a space frame, herein referred to as a Flowline Connection Module (FCM) is removably interposed between the subsea wellhead and the subsea christmas tree to facilitate the piping connections. Each of the modules is further provided with removable U-looped pipework spools at its extremities and said spools may contain adjustable chokes to control the flow of fluids into or out of the wells. The replacement of one choke spool with another may adapt the service function of the well from, for example, production to water injection.

    Abstract: A subsea guidepost latch mechanism which latches a guidepost to a guidepost-receptacle by means of an external snap ring on the guidepost and an internal groove in the guidepost-receptacle. The snap ring is held in the groove by a collet inside the snap ring which is forced outward by an inner mandrel in the guidepost when upward tension is placed on the mandrel by a guideline. The guidepost is released from the guidepost-receptacle by releasing tension on the guideline which allows the mandrel to drop, releasing outward force on the collet and the snap ring. This allows the snap ring to be pulled out of the guidepost-receptacle groove.

    Abstract: A method of replacing a corroded well conductor positioned in an oil production platform at an offshore location. After shutting in or killing the well, the wellhead is removed and the sections of the casing and tubing strings within the well conductor above the mud line are backed off and removed. The damaged well conductor is cut off above the mud line leaving a stub to which the lower end of a new section of well conductor is connected and bonded by means of a novel connector. Communication between the old and new sections of well conductor is established and the casing and tubing sections are re-installed in the new well conductor and the wellhead is closed.

    Abstract: A method and apparatus is disclosed for eliminating vertical motion of a downhole tool in a subsea borehole as the tool is being operated by a drill string from a floating vessel. A vertical motion elimination means is incorporated into the drill string at a point which will be adjacent a blowout preventer stack on the marine bottom when the downhole tool is positioned at a desired point in the borehole. The vertical motion elimination means is comprised of a sleeve which is rotatably mounted on the drill string at a fixed vertical position. The sleeve is adapted to be engaged by the blowout preventer stack to fix the sleeve against vertical movement with respect to the preventer. Since the sleeve, itself, is fixed against vertical movement on the drill string, that portion of the drill string which lies below the preventer (hence, the downhole tool) will also be fixed against vertical motion within the borehole.

    Abstract: A marine riser system for use in deep water drilling operations from a floating vessel is disclosed. The riser system permits detachment of the lower end of the riser from the wellhead enabling the riser to be set aside to a position which is clear of the wellhead. Support means adjacent the wellhead can be used to support and position the riser when it is set aside. Tensioners, support mechanisms and guidance means are provided to move the riser back and forth between the wellhead and support means. In this manner, casing and tools having diameters larger than that of the riser can be inserted into the wellhead without returning the riser to the surface. Drilling operations with large diameter drill bits can also be conducted with the riser in the set aside position.
